Avon House is a lovely 16 bedroom private Residential Care Home that has held a strong local reputation for many years. Because Avon House is small it is able to provide a homely and relaxed atmosphere and can cater to the individual needs of residents. All bedrooms are en-suite and residents are welcome to bring their own personal possessions.

Review from Peter E (Respite Resident) published on 8 February 2018 Submitted via Postal Card
Overall Experience
Impressive building set in large garden. Entrance hall welcoming. Greeted with pleasure, decoration of building is clean and fresh. Food very good and served on time. Plenty of staff in ratio to patients. Organised afternoons, organised for exercise, scrabble with students from local college, model making. Residents are encouraged to help staff lay-up tables. Flower arranging organised- the flowers are put on show.

In all, Avon House is a well run, friendly home. Thoroughly recommended.

Review from Ann D (Daughter of Resident) published on 7 February 2017 Submitted via Website
Overall Experience

Late last year we had the difficult task of bringing my father, an 'Alzheimer's' sufferer, from his house in Cheshire to a home, nearer to us, in West Sussex.

We visited several homes in the area.

We chose 'Avon House' based on one, simple, criterion: care. The management and staff at Avon House care for the residents, their welfare is of paramount importance. This being the case, everything else: accommodation, hygiene, quality of food etc. falls quite naturally into place.

Putting a parent into a home can never be a pleasant experience - Avon House makes it as positive an experience as it could possibly be, for all concerned.
